Commit
e208f9c introduced a macro to turn error() calls
into:
(error(), -1)
to make the constant return value more visible to the
calling code (and thus let the compiler make better
decisions about the code).
This works well for code like:
return error(...);
but the "-1" is superfluous in code that just calls error()
without caring about the return value. In older versions of
gcc, that was fine, but gcc 4.9 complains with -Wunused-value.
We can work around this by encapsulating the constant return
value in a static inline function, as gcc specifically
avoids complaining about unused function returns unless the
function has been specifically marked with the
warn_unused_result attribute.
We also use the same trick for config_error_nonbool and
opterror, which learned the same error technique in
a469a10.
